WebJul 14, 2024 · A-Wedge Loft. An A-Wedge or Approach Wedge has between 48 to 51 degrees of loft, with 50 to 51 degrees being the most common. An Approach Wedge/Gap Wedge, along with a Pitching Wedge, often comes with a set of irons. It's helpful to think of your PW as a 10-iron and an AW as an 11-iron. WebThere are several differences between wedges. The main focal point boils down to the loft of the golf club. Gap wedges typically range from 50°-52°, sand wedges can range from 54°-56°, and lob wedges range can range from 58°-64°. The higher the loft of the wedge, the shorter the distance the ball will travel in total distance.

WebJan 31, 2024 · Lob Wedge. The lob wedge is the most lofted club in a golfer's bag, typically with a loft of 58 to 60 degrees, although some club manufacturers are offering lob wedges with up to 64 degrees of loft.
